ANEMONE

Shay Shalem as Nili and Hila Kremer as Eden in ANEMONE. Photo by Austin Patterson.
Written, co-directed, and produced by Michael Valdes.
Sold-out New York premiere at The New School’s APEX Festival, 2026.
An intimate bilingual English-Hebrew play exploring friendship, Jewish and Israeli identity, grief, belonging, and the ways events thousands of miles away can enter the most personal spaces of our lives.
